A Forbes writer has written an article stating that the previous Forbes article about how this year's Astros are the most profitable team ever was erroneous, and the basis of the article is what you're saying:



The writer goes on to say that even if CSN Houston was a huge success with numerous carriage agreements the Astros wouldn't be making anywhere near the $80 million the previous article states because with regional sports nets there are huge startup costs and teams don't start making huge money until the later years of a deal.

http://www.forbes.com/sites/maurybro...ive-strikeout/
I just read this and was about to post the link as well. As I said earlier, I find it hard to believe that the Astros are making that much money.

Word going around is Miguel Cabrera just went down with an apparent Hammy Injury

Quote:


Miguel Cabrera left Wednesday's game against the Athletics with an apparent left hamstring injury.
Cabrera grabbed at the back of his left leg after an awkward slide into second base. He's been limping around for weeks and has still managed to continue raking, but it might be time for the slugger to take a few consecutive days off. The Tigers will provide an update on the injury soon.
Source: Tom Gage on Twitter

Quote:
Originally Posted by sycro View Post
I must have missed that when I read it. He does have the potential to be.... but he needs another 12-15 years of this kind of dominance which is ultra-rare.

But, he is the best active reliever right now. Not the historically best active reliever, but for 2011-2013, he is the best.
Check the numbers, Kimbrel's three plus seasons are an extended stretch of dominance that no reliever has ever matched in the history of the game, including Mariano. A 292 ERA+ over 220 innings. He's redefining what a pitcher is capable of as a reliever. The only knock one could lodge would be throwing him up against relievers of the '70s, who pitched more innings in their big seasons. By all the important rate stats, he's already the best closer in history next to Eric Gagne's steroid-aided peak.
